Output adb18a4ebce108564e307a04af6adb57d38eb2d268af7d8e7ecfc5ad3f667e21:0

value
24668
script pubkey
OP_0 OP_PUSHBYTES_32 907fbd7e7e603c734296d9a4cbbd5d9caae6675d7799f367b1cf1d0edfeec2bb
address
bc1qjplm6ln7vq78xs5kmxjvh02anj4wve6aw7vlxea3euwsahlwc2asyj09wq
transaction
adb18a4ebce108564e307a04af6adb57d38eb2d268af7d8e7ecfc5ad3f667e21
confirmations
58248
spent
true